US to Release 172 Million Barrels of Oil from Strategic Reserve to Tackle Soaring Prices

US Energy Secretary Chris Wright said yesterday that the country will ​release 172 million barrels of oil from its strategic ‌petroleum reserve in a bid to reduce oil prices that have soared due to supply shocks from the US-Israeli war on ​Iran. Wright said the release is part of a broader ⁠release of 400 million barrels of oil agreed ​to by the 32-nation International Energy Agency earlier in the ​day. Wright said the release will begin next week and will take about 120 days to deliver.
 
Raising the ‌stakes ⁠for the global economy, Iran’s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ps said it would block oil shipments from the Gulf unless the U.S. and Israeli attacks cease. The war ​has shaken markets ​around the ⁠world.
